Beyond the Sign: A Holistic Approach to Pedestrian Safety

While regulatory signage forms a crucial pillar of pedestrian safety, it’s rarely a standalone solution. A truly effective approach requires a layered strategy that considers the entire intersection environment and driver behavior Worth keeping that in mind..

Infrastructure Enhancements

Simply installing a sign isn't enough. Complementary infrastructure improvements significantly bolster safety:

  • High-Visibility Crosswalk Markings: Bold, contrasting crosswalk markings, particularly ladder-style or continental markings, increase visibility for drivers, especially in low-light conditions.
  • Pedestrian Islands: These provide a safe refuge for pedestrians crossing wide streets, allowing them to complete the crossing in two stages.
  • Raised Crosswalks: These physically slow down vehicles and increase pedestrian visibility, acting as a visual and tactile cue for drivers.
  • Curb Extensions (Bulb-Outs): Shorten crossing distances and improve pedestrian visibility by bringing them closer to the center of the road.
  • Lighting Improvements: Adequate street lighting is essential, particularly at night, to illuminate pedestrians and crosswalks.

Technological Advancements

Emerging technologies offer further opportunities to enhance pedestrian safety:

  • Automated Enforcement: Systems that use cameras to detect and ticket drivers who fail to yield to pedestrians in crosswalks.
  • Connected Vehicle Technology: Vehicles equipped with technology that can alert drivers to the presence of pedestrians, even if they are obscured from view.
  • Smart Crosswalks: Crosswalks equipped with sensors that detect pedestrian presence and activate flashing lights or other visual cues to alert drivers.
